A number of different programs are available to help you improve your game. For example, you can use software to store hand histories and analyze the odds of winning and losing. Many programs will also scan your hands for mistakes and show you your previous statistics. Some programs will even quiz you on the games that you have won or lost, so that you can learn from them.
